What is a Client Consent Form?
The Client Consent Form is a critical legal document required across various professional sectors in the United States. It serves to protect both service providers and clients by clearly documenting informed consent and understanding of services provided. This document typically includes detailed information about the services, risks, benefits, privacy policies, and client rights. The form must adhere to federal regulations like HIPAA and state-specific requirements, and may need to be updated as regulations change. It's particularly important in healthcare, legal, and professional service settings where clear documentation of consent is legally required.

When do you need this document?
You need a Client Consent Form whenever you collect personal information, provide professional services, or handle sensitive data that requires documented consent under federal law. Healthcare providers must obtain written consent before accessing or sharing patient information under HIPAA regulations. Legal professionals require consent forms when representing clients or handling confidential matters. Financial advisors and consultants need documented consent when accessing credit information subject to FCRA requirements. Mental health professionals must secure consent before providing therapy services, especially when treating minors who require parental or guardian consent. Any business collecting consumer data for marketing purposes needs clear consent documentation to comply with FTC regulations and emerging state privacy laws.
Key legal considerations
Your consent form must include specific elements to ensure legal validity and regulatory compliance. The services description section must clearly outline the scope and limitations of services being provided, avoiding ambiguous language that could create legal disputes. Your consent statement requires explicit, understandable language detailing exactly what the client is agreeing to, including any risks or limitations associated with your services. The confidentiality statement must address how you will protect client information and under what circumstances information may be disclosed, ensuring HIPAA compliance where applicable. You must clearly outline both your rights and responsibilities as the service provider and your client's rights, including their right to withdraw consent. When serving clients with disabilities, your form must meet ADA accessibility requirements, potentially requiring alternative formats or communication methods. For services involving minors, you need additional provisions for parental or legal guardian consent and signature requirements.
Legal requirements in United States
Under United States federal law, your Client Consent Form must comply with multiple regulatory frameworks depending on your industry and services provided. HIPAA requires healthcare providers to obtain written authorization before using or disclosing protected health information, with specific language requirements and expiration provisions. The Americans with Disabilities Act mandates that consent forms be accessible to individuals with disabilities, requiring reasonable accommodations such as large print, audio formats, or sign language interpretation. FCRA compliance is mandatory when your services involve accessing consumer credit information, requiring specific disclosures about credit checks and consumer rights. FTC regulations demand clear and conspicuous disclosures when collecting consumer information for marketing purposes, with opt-out mechanisms clearly explained. If you handle data from EU citizens, you must incorporate GDPR-compliant consent provisions with granular opt-in requirements. State privacy laws vary significantly, with California's CCPA, Virginia's CDPA, and other emerging state regulations requiring additional consent provisions and consumer rights disclosures. Your form must be signed by all relevant parties, including witnesses when required by state law, and maintained according to industry-specific record retention requirements.
